12 Design Nail Sticker Set Flowers Maple Leaf Leopard Print Nail Art Water Transfer Decal Slider Floral Leaf Manicure Decoration

12 Design Nail Sticker Set Flowers Maple Leaf Leopard Print Nail Art Water Transfer Decal Slider Floral Leaf Manicure Decoration
thumb
thumb
thumb
thumb
thumb
sku: 1005003266354920
$4.28
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ed